The ball is just moments away from being dropped. What does 2008 have in store for us? Plenty. Read on for a list of a few of my favorite upcoming things.

Babies:  The stork is going to be one busy bird. Jennifer Lopez, Jessica Alba, Halle Berry and Nicole Richie will become first-time moms. So will Jamie Lynn Spears, but that whole situation still gives me the willies, so I’m not yet sure I wanna see the latest from the Spears spawning department.

Jennifer Hudson's Debut Album:  We’ve been hearing about this album since the second Ms. Hudson took home her Dreamgirls Oscar in February. But that’s okay. With Clive Davis mentoring her, I’m sure it’s going to be well worth the wait.  

The Sex and the City Movie: Carrie and her friends are back! Now, let’s see what we can do about convincing them to return as a television series. My Sunday nights have never been the same since they said goodbye.

Lindsay Lohan's Clean Living:  Her love life may continue to have its ups and downs, but it looks like Ms. Lohan is rockin’ with her recovery. If she stays on course, I still think L.Lo’s got a chance for a major movie comeback.

9 to 5, the Musical:  As you all know by now, I am a mega Dolly Parton fan. I’ve been waiting for this musical adaptation of her hit 1980 movie for, like, forever. Ms. Parton’s written something like 18 songs for the production. It’ll hit Broadway after it debuts in Los Angeles in September.

Madonna Gregg DeGuire/WireImage.com

Madonna's Licorice:  It has been a gazillion years since the Material Mom released her first album. In April, we’re getting a new one, which is reportedly going to be called Licorice. If the accompanying concert tour is anything like her last one, I’m there. If I can dance and sweat again like I did at her concert stop at L.A.’s Staples Center, I will be one happy gay.

The Oprah Factor:  Will she help secure enough votes for Barack Obama to win the White House, or even the Democratic nomination?

More Dancing with the Stars:  I never really watched DWTS, but then I had to last season because I was running a weekly postperformance Q&A with the hunky Cameron Mathison. Now I’m hooked.

More First-Time Mamas:  Who will be the next starlet with a belly bump? Eva Longoria? Katherine Heigl? Rebecca Romijn? Or maybe my E! pal Giuliana Rancic?
